A Full Screen Is a Strong Design Choice
Taking over a phone display immediately creates focus. It can remove competing controls, establish a clear next step, and give a complex task enough room to breathe. That strength also creates risk. A full-screen interruption that appears for a minor update, optional promotion, or routine confirmation can make users feel blocked rather than supported. The larger the interruption, the stronger and more timely its reason must be.
A useful example is the first-time setup for a feature that needs several decisions, such as connecting a calendar, choosing notification preferences, and confirming permissions. Presenting that flow as a full-screen overlay can help users complete it without losing their place in the surrounding app.
What a Full-Screen Overlay Should Do
A full-screen overlay is a temporary surface that covers the app’s current view and places attention on a single, contained experience. Unlike a toast, which provides brief status feedback, or an inline message, which belongs beside a related field, an overlay deliberately pauses the background task.
It works best when it has one job: guide a new task, present a focused choice, communicate a time-sensitive warning, or support an immersive activity such as recording video, scanning a document, editing an image, or viewing media. A dialog is usually better for a short question. A bottom sheet fits a handful of quick choices. A drawer supports movement between app sections without fully breaking context.
Onboarding and Complex Setup
Use a short onboarding sequence when users need context to act confidently. Explain the benefit first, request only necessary information, and show progress for a multi-step setup. Breaking a complicated process into calm, focused screens is often easier than squeezing instructions into a small modal.

Critical Alerts and High-Impact Decisions
Reserve this pattern for issues users should not overlook, such as an expired security session, a payment failure that prevents a booked service from being completed, or a required permission to complete an active task. The screen should state what happened, why it matters, and what users can do next. Do not use urgency as a design trick.
Focused Creation and Clear Completion
Camera capture, uploads, recording, editing, and scanning benefit from a distraction-free space. Full-screen overlays can also make major completion states feel clear after a booking, submission, or saved item, provided the confirmation includes useful next actions instead of decorative celebration alone.
Give the Overlay One Clear Job
Put the essential message near the top of the visual hierarchy, then make the primary action unmistakable. In most cases, one primary button and one secondary option are enough. Labels should describe outcomes: “Allow Access,” “Save Changes,” “Retry Upload,” or “Return to Booking.” Avoid vague labels such as “Continue” when users cannot tell what will happen.
Remove unrelated links, excessive illustrations, and competing calls to action. If the task contains multiple steps, show progress with simple language such as “Step 2 of 3.” Keep instructions short enough to scan, and explain any consequences before users commit to an irreversible action.
Build a Reliable Dismissal Path
When dismissal is safe, include a visible close control and support the device back action according to platform expectations. Outside taps are appropriate only when closing cannot discard work or create confusion. If users can leave halfway through, explain whether progress is saved, paused, or lost.
There are exceptions. An overlay that handles a required security action may not allow dismissal until the user signs out or resolves the issue. Even then, the screen should explain why leaving is unavailable and provide a meaningful alternative, such as contacting support or returning after connectivity is restored.
Design for Accessibility From the First Wireframe
Move accessibility focus into the overlay when it opens, keep the reading order logical, and return focus to the control that launched it when it closes. Icons need meaningful labels, text and controls need strong contrast, and large-text settings must not hide buttons below the fold.
Do not rely on color, sound, or animation alone to communicate status. Provide visible text for errors and success states, ensure controls have usable touch targets, and respect reduced-motion preferences. Motion should clarify a change in context, not delay the next action or make important content harder to reach.
Handle Responsive Layouts Across Devices
A narrow-phone layout should not simply stretch across a tablet, foldable, or resizable window. Following Android’s adaptive layout guidance helps teams respond to available space rather than treating every display as a larger phone.
- Use flexible spacing, readable line lengths, and maximum content widths.
- Reflow actions when orientation changes, rather than allowing controls to crowd together.
- Respect safe areas, display cutouts, system bars, and keyboard space.
- Consider changing a full-screen phone treatment into a centered panel or split layout on larger screens.
Prevent Intrusive Overlays
A helpful interruption appears at a natural pause and solves an immediate problem. An intrusive one blocks the main task for optional content, repeats after every visit, or appears before users can reach what they came for. Store completion and dismissal states when appropriate. Delay non-urgent requests until users have context, and never repeatedly demand the same answer after a clear decline. If the overlay is important, tell users why it appeared at this moment.
Test the Full User Journey
Testing should go beyond the ideal path. Open the overlay from every expected entry point, complete the primary task, dismiss it, reopen it, and confirm that users return to the right place. Test rotation, different window sizes, large text, screen readers, keyboard input, reduced motion, slow connections, empty states, denied permissions, and failed uploads.
Measure Whether the Pattern Helps
Track completion rate, time to completion, form errors, abandonment, accidental dismissals, repeated opens, and repeat exposure. Compare results with a dialog, bottom sheet, or inline version when possible. Rising dismissal rates may indicate fatigue, while prolonged screen time may reveal unclear instructions rather than thoughtful engagement.
Practical Review Checklist
- Does this overlay solve a clear user problem at the right moment?
- Can users understand the message and find the main action within seconds?
- Can they leave safely, with unfinished work handled clearly?
- Does the experience adapt across screen sizes and assistive technologies?
- Have real-user tests and analytics shown that it performs better than a lighter pattern?
Conclusion
Full-screen overlays work when focus is genuinely valuable. They should guide, protect, or support an important task, not merely demand attention. Keep the purpose narrow, the actions clear, the exit path understandable, and the layout adaptive. Done well, a full-screen experience feels like useful space for the task at hand, not an obstacle placed in front of it.
